Output 77514214bcfcef86dcfcc7de63eabbea1192bf9a93aea18f375a2aa1b1b57b2c:1

value
1000956
script pubkey
OP_0 OP_PUSHBYTES_20 86d563b8e2d7262ea8bea40138b4dcb849228c83
address
ltc1qsm2k8w8z6unza2975sqn3dxuhpyj9ryrjhw0k7
transaction
77514214bcfcef86dcfcc7de63eabbea1192bf9a93aea18f375a2aa1b1b57b2c
spent
true